Mazda Radar Cruise Control (MRCC)
Do not use the MRCC system in the following locations, using the MRCC
system at the following locations may result in an unexpected accident:
• General roads other than highways.
• Roads with sharp curves and where vehicle traffic is heavy and there is
insufficient space between vehicles.
• Roads where frequent and repetitive acceleration and deceleration occur.
• When entering and exiting interchanges, service areas, and parking areas
of highways.
• Slippery roads such as ice or snow-bound roads.
• Long, descending slopes.
• Slopes with a steep gradient
For safety purposes, switch the MRCC system off when it is not being used.
NOTE
• The MRCC system does not detect the following as physical objects.
• Vehicles approaching in the opposite direction
• Pedestrians
• Stationary objects (stopped vehicles, obstructions)
• If a vehicle ahead is travelling at an extremely low speed, the system may
not detect it correctly.
